Cope, Smith win weight classes, Blue Jays place 3rd at Shenandoah Invitational

WINCHESTER, Va. -- Corey Cope and Ganon Smith each won their weight classes for the second time this season and the Elizabethtown College wrestling team had a place-finisher in nine of the 10 weights to take third out of 11 teams at the Shenandoah Invitational with 152 points.

Cope and Smith, along with Will Davis, have each been off to impressive starts to the season. All three have won their weight class multiple times this season already. On Saturday at Shenandoah, it was Cope and Smith that ran the table to capture their titles. For Cope, it was a pinfall within the opening minute. Smith used a 4-0 decision in his first-place match to grab the 184-pound title.

Davis was one of two runner-up finishers for Elizabethtown. He lost a 7-4 decision at 197 while Ksawery Niewiadomy took second at 285.

Braden Schuyler (133) and Justice Hockenberry (165) took their third-place matches for the Blue Jays. Hockenberry won over his teammate Gavin Fehr, who was fourth at 165. Daniel Corbin (125) was also a fourth-place finisher for Etown.

Owen Heffner battled to a fifth-place finish at 133 as did David Panone at 141. Gavin Wagner did the same at 197 for the Jays.

Febian Dawit (133), Ethan Bliss (157), and Caleb Bowlin (174) were also contributors to EC's point total. Dawit took seventh while Bliss and Bowlin were eighth in their weight class.

The Blue Jays had multiple placers in three of the nine weight classes, including four at 133.

Elizabethtown will host Wilkes on Friday, Nov. 22, for Alumni Night.
